What Exactly is Kinetic Sand?

You might be surprised to learn that even though it doesn’t have the same appearance or texture as traditional sand, kinetic sand is actually sand. Yes, that’s right, it's virtually the same stuff you find on a beach, but with a very important difference. The only real distinction is that instead of being coated using water, which is how you might try to make a sandcastle at the beach, kinetic sand is treated with something else entirely. This coating is what gives it its truly unique characteristics, allowing it to act in ways that plain old sand simply can't, so it's a pretty big deal.

Its Unique Makeup

So, what exactly is this magical coating? Well, kinetic sand is sand that's coated with a silicone oil. This special oil lends the sand its very unique viscoelastic properties. Think of it this way: it's a type of sand coated with silicone oils that allow the sand to both change shape under pressure but also maintain its structural integrity. It's really quite clever, actually. The trademarked kinetic sand, for example, is created by mixing fine sand with a silicone substance and oil. This combination is what creates that buttery soft sand texture that can hold shape like wet sand, but without the mess or the need for water.

To be a bit more specific, the composition is quite precise. Kinetic sand is made of about 98% sand and 2% polydimethylsiloxane. This polymer is the key ingredient that binds the sand together so it doesn’t just fall apart like dry sand. In some cases, the sand grains are coated with a compound called trimethylsilanol, which has hydrophobic properties. This coating repels water, allowing the sand to maintain its special consistency without drying out, which is a very useful feature, as a matter of fact. Viscoelastic Properties Explained

Kinetic sand’s magic lies in its viscoelastic properties. This means it has qualities of both a viscous liquid and an elastic solid. Imagine a material that can stretch and deform, like something elastic, but also flow slowly, like something thick and gooey. That’s essentially what kinetic sand does. When you apply pressure, like when you squeeze it, the sand grains, coated with their special polymer, slide past each other, allowing the sand to change form. But as soon as that pressure is released, the polymer binds the sand together, allowing it to maintain its structural integrity, so it doesn't just form a shapeless pile.

The science behind kinetic sand is largely regular or play sand, making up about 98 percent of its composition, mixed with a polymer. This polymer is a long, repeating chain of molecules that gives the sand its stretchy property. It’s this molecular structure that allows the sand to stick to itself, not your hands, which is a very important distinction. It’s also why it can be molded into various shapes and still hold them firmly, yet easily crumble when you want it to. Why It Never Dries Out

One of the most amazing things about kinetic sand is that it magically sticks together and never dries out. This means you can create again, and again, and again! This incredible feature is directly related to its unique coating. Unlike traditional sand, which relies on water to hold its shape (and then dries out, making your sandcastle crumble), kinetic sand uses silicone oil or a similar polymer. This coating doesn't evaporate like water does. It forms a permanent bond around each sand grain, which is pretty neat.

The coating, often trimethylsilanol, has hydrophobic properties, meaning it repels water. This is key because it prevents moisture from interacting with the sand in a way that would cause it to dry out or lose its special texture. So, you don’t need to worry about sealing it up tightly or adding water to revive it. It just stays soft and moldable, ready for play whenever you are. Comparing with Traditional and Moon Sand

Traditional play sand, the kind you find in a sandbox, needs water to hold its shape. Without water, it's just loose grains that fall apart easily, leaving a dusty mess. It’s great for building, but once it dries, your creations crumble, and it can be quite messy to clean up. Kinetic sand, on the other hand, doesn't need water at all to stick together. Its silicone coating does all the work, allowing it to hold its shape like wet sand but without the actual wetness, which is a pretty big deal.

Moon sand, sometimes called "cloud dough," is another popular moldable material. It’s typically made from sand mixed with cornstarch and oil, giving it a soft, crumbly texture that can be pressed into shapes. However, moon sand tends to be more powdery and less "flowy" than kinetic sand. It doesn't have that unique viscoelastic property where it stretches and slowly oozes. Kinetic sand maintains a cohesive, almost living quality, while moon sand is more about compacting and crumbling.
